On Thu, Sep 23, 2021 at 11:56:25AM -0700, Eric Biggers wrote:
> This series renames struct blk_keyslot_manager to struct
> blk_crypto_profile, as it is misnamed; it doesn't always manage
> keyslots. It's much more logical to think of it as the
> "blk-crypto profile" of a device, similar to blk_integrity_profile.
>
> This series also improves the inline-encryption.rst documentation file,
> and cleans up blk-crypto-fallback a bit.
>
> This series applies to v5.15-rc2.
